The article "Standards in space" from Nature discusses the need for establishing universal standards and regulations for space activities as commercial and international operations increase. It addresses challenges in creating consistent protocols for satellite operations, space debris management, and coordination among different space agencies and private companies. The piece emphasizes that without agreed-upon standards, the growing congestion in Earth's orbit poses risks to both current and future space missions.


As space becomes increasingly crowded with satellites from multiple nations and private entities, lack of standardization could lead to collisions, communication failures, and unsafe operating conditions. Establishing international standards is critical for sustainable space exploration and protecting valuable orbital infrastructure that supports global communications, navigation, and scientific research.
